Как научиться ботать по фене

Автор АНТИ ПЕТУХ, Март 12, 2024, 06:03

« назад - далее »

АНТИ ПЕТУХ

Шаги для новичков: как научиться создавать ботов по фене. Простой план: как начать ботать по фене без сложностей

Artcross



Важно отметить, что создание бота для автоматического выполнения определенных действий в интернете (например, ботание) может быть незаконным или нарушать политику использования веб-сайтов. Пожалуйста, убедитесь, что ваши действия согласуются с законом и правилами конкретного веб-ресурса, на который вы планируете направить своего бота.


Шаг 1:

 Определение цели бота
Прежде чем начать создание бота, определите, что именно вы хотите достичь. Например, вы можете захотеть создать бота для автоматизации определенных действий на веб-сайте, таких как автоматическое заполнение форм, сканирование цен на товары, автоматическое взаимодействие с пользователями и т. д.


Шаг 2:

 Изучение алгоритмов и инструментов
После определения цели изучите различные алгоритмы и инструменты, которые могут помочь вам в создании бота. В зависимости от ваших потребностей и навыков программирования, вы можете использовать различные языки программирования, библиотеки и фреймворки.


Шаг 3:

 Изучение веб-скрапинга (web scraping)
В большинстве случаев для создания бота вам потребуется извлекать информацию с веб-сайтов. Для этого вам пригодятся знания в области веб-скрапинга - процесса извлечения данных с веб-страниц. Освойте базовые принципы HTML и CSS, а также изучите инструменты для веб-скрапинга, такие как BeautifulSoup для Python.


Шаг 4:

 Разработка бота
На этом этапе вы начинаете создавать бота с использованием выбранного вами языка программирования и инструментов. Создайте скрипт, который будет загружать страницы веб-сайта, извлекать необходимую информацию и выполнять требуемые действия. Обратите внимание, что в процессе разработки вам может потребоваться решить различные технические проблемы, такие как управление сеансами, обход защиты от ботов и т. д.


Пример:




Предположим, что вы хотите создать бота для сбора информации о ценах на определенный товар на веб-сайте онлайн-магазина. Вот примерный план действий:



  • Изучите структуру веб-страницы магазина и определите, где находится информация о ценах.
  • Напишите скрипт на Python с использованием библиотеки BeautifulSoup для веб-скрапинга.
  • С помощью скрипта загрузите страницу товара, извлеките информацию о цене и сохраните ее в базу данных или файле.
  • Настройте регулярное выполнение скрипта (например, с помощью cron в Unix-подобных системах) для регулярного обновления информации о ценах.
  • Опционально:

     добавьте дополнительные функции, такие как уведомления по электронной почте о изменениях цен.

Важно помнить, что создание бота может быть сложным процессом, требующим не только технических навыков, но и понимания этики и законности использования таких инструментов. Перед началом работы убедитесь, что ваш бот соблюдает правила веб-сайта и местные законы.